Mara Valpolicella Ripasso Superiore Corvina Blend 2018

Dark red color with a copper tinge. Aromas of dark red fruit. Medium body. Entry has a hint of sweetness. Dry with dark cherry, tobacco, little coffee notes. Very bright acidity for such an old wine brings it to a perfect balance. Tannins are there, but well balanced. Excellent wine.

Tenuta Monolo

Riserva Bramaterra Nebbiolo Blend 2000

2000 | Red Blend
(60% Nebbiolo / 20% Croatina/ 10% Vespolina / 10% Uva Rara)
Tenuta Monolo (Umberto Gilodi); Riserva Piedmont; Bramaterra, Italy
(91-93; Drink 2020-2028)

Far better than prior bottles of 2000 a year or so ago, I'm now convinced those earlier bottles were flawed in some fashion.
